Location
With a stay at The Talbot Hotel in Stourbridge, you'll be within a 15-minute drive of Black Country Living Museum and Quest. This hotel is 8.9 mi (14.2 km) from West Midland Safari Park and 13.9 mi (22.3 km) from Utilita Arena Birmingham.

Dining
At The Talbot Hotel, enjoy a satisfying meal at the restaurant. Mingle with other guests at the complimentary reception, held daily.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ge.

Roo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 52 gu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Bathrooms with bathtubs or showers are provided.

Great value and excellent location, particularly for public transportation. I have stayed several times. Pub is closed, no food and drinks available, but you’re on Stourbridge High Street, independent cafe near rear access and Greggs + Starbucks near front access, Wetherspoons 5 minutes walk. It’s a medieval building so some bits are wonky or tight. Sometimes a niggle with the cleaning or no new coffee/tea supplies but staff are great and have always sorted satisfactorily. Parking is at rear and can get busy, do not forget to enter car registration in the iPad at front desk, otherwise you’ll be sent a parking charge. 10 minutes walk to Stourbridge bus station (access to Brierley Hill, Merry Hill, Dudley, Birmingham, Wolverhampton and other places), same site is Stourbridge Town rail link to Stourbridge Junction (from SBJ direct trains to Kidderminster, Severn Valley Railway, Worcester, Birmingham, Solihull, Stratford upon Avon regular services plus a few trains a day to/from London Marylebone).
